ServiceNow unworried by Salesforce firing shots across its bow


In October, Salesforce debuted Agentforce IT in a direct challenge to ServiceNow’s ITSM product, and analyst firm Forrester’s vice president and principal analyst Charles Betz rated it the “most credible threat” ServiceNow has ever faced.

ServiceNow isn’t worried.

“We’re not talking about models. We’re not talking about things that are commoditized,” Heath Ramsey, the company’s group vice president of outbound project management for the AI platform, told The Register.

“People are talking about workflow. We feel like we do it better. I know we do it better. We become a platform for work in the enterprise and we also become the AI control tower for work in the enterprise,” he added.
